Antimicrobial Catheters Industry Overview
Infection Prevention Remains a Primary Industry Focus
The antimicrobial catheters industry continues to evolve as healthcare providers seek advanced solutions to reduce healthcare-associated infections and improve patient outcomes. Catheter-related bloodstream infections and catheter-associated urinary tract infections remain major clinical concerns across hospitals, dialysis centers, and long-term care facilities. Manufacturers are increasingly developing catheter technologies designed to prevent bacterial colonization, reduce biofilm formation, and support long-term device safety. Growing emphasis on infection prevention, antimicrobial stewardship, and patient safety is driving innovation across vascular access, urinary catheterization, and hemodialysis applications.
Evidence-Based Approaches Enhancing Catheter Infection Management
Clinical management strategies for catheter-related bloodstream infections are becoming increasingly sophisticated through the adoption of evidence-based treatment frameworks. Recent scientific reviews have emphasized the role of antimicrobial lock therapy as a critical component of catheter salvage protocols, particularly in patients requiring long-term central venous access or hemodialysis treatment. These frameworks aim to preserve catheter function while minimizing infection-related complications. Additionally, researchers are highlighting the need for prospective validation of artificial intelligence-assisted diagnostic tools capable of improving infection detection and treatment decision-making. The combination of advanced therapeutic protocols and digital health technologies is supporting more effective management of catheter-related infections while reducing healthcare burdens associated with device-associated complications.
Artificial Intelligence Transforming Catheter Design Innovation
Artificial intelligence is emerging as a powerful tool for improving catheter performance through advanced engineering and computational modeling. Researchers are utilizing geometry-focused Fourier neural operators to optimize internal catheter structures that actively discourage bacterial migration. These AI-assisted designs are intended to suppress bacterial upstream swimming, a key mechanism contributing to catheter contamination and infection development. Experimental models have demonstrated the potential to reduce bacterial contamination levels by up to one hundredfold compared with conventional catheter designs. The application of artificial intelligence in device engineering is enabling manufacturers to create more effective infection-resistant products while advancing the broader field of smart medical device development.
Non-Antibiotic Surface Technologies Driving Next-Generation Products
A major trend within the antimicrobial catheters market is the shift toward non-antibiotic surface technologies that reduce microbial colonization without contributing to antimicrobial resistance. Manufacturers are investing in innovative materials such as zwitterionic polymers, nitric oxide-releasing surfaces, and antimicrobial peptide coatings designed to provide durable protection and improved biocompatibility. These technologies offer potential advantages over traditional silver-alloy and antibiotic-impregnated catheters by delivering long-lasting antimicrobial activity while minimizing resistance concerns. In parallel, Bactiguard continues to advance its Bactiguard Infection Protection technology through the development of Foley urinary catheters featuring noble metal coatings intended to reduce catheter-associated urinary tract infections. These innovations reflect the industry's broader commitment to infection prevention, regulatory compliance, and the development of safer, more effective catheter technologies for modern healthcare environments.

France Market Size, Growth Rate, and Forecast Analysis to 2034- Universal healthcare system, high public healthcare expenditure, and strong government support Antimicrobial Catheters sales through 2034
France Antimicrobial Catheters companies are emphasizing on opportunities for rapid, at-scale innovation to boost profitability over the long-term. The country’s National Health Insurance spending target (ONDAM) estimates 3.7% growth in the country’s healthcare expenditure. Over the forecast period, expenditure control measures, chronic disease management initiatives, workforce reforms, and efforts to improve system efficiency drive the long-term prospects.
The biggest 2026 policy frame is the PLFSS 2026. The law sets the Maladie branch spending target at €271.4 billion for 2026 and fixes the ONDAM at €117.5 billion for city care, €112.8 billion for health establishments, and €18.3 billion for elderly-care establishments and services. France’s market is also being pulled by demographics. INSEE estimates that on 1 January 2026 France had 69.1 million inhabitants, with 22% aged 65 or over. INSEE also reported that 2025 births were 645,000 and deaths were 651,000, producing a negative natural balance of about 6,000 for the first time since the end of the Second World War.
UK Antimicrobial Catheters Market Size, Share, and Growth Projections to 2034- Rapid growth driven by new and existing brands across the industry value chain
Small high-need consumer segments remain key priority of Antimicrobial Catheters distributors in the UK industry. Continuous launch of new products coupled with high expenditures support the market outlook. The UK Government financing remains the dominant funding source at 81.3% of total healthcare expenditure, or £280 billion in 2025. According to the ONS, total healthcare spending grew 7.7% nominally and 3.9% in real terms from 2024 to 2025. Similarly, out-of-pocket spending was £49 billion (14.1%) and voluntary health insurance was £9.5 billion (2.8%). The market is driven by rapid digital adoption with NHS England’s plan to give more than 500,000 staff access to new AI tools.
